Success implicit view refers to the concept of success existing in the minds of ordinary people,including the understanding and views of ordinary individuals on success,which is different from the definition of success given by authoritative experts.Different from the measurement of the individual's implicit cognition temporarily triggered by specific situational factors in the experimental manipulation situation,it takes the group as a unit to reveal the commonly held cognition view,so the self-assessment questionnaire is often used.At present,there have been a lot of researches on the use of questionnaires to measure people's certain implicit view,such as creativity implicit view,intelligence implicit view,personality implicit view,moral emotion implicit view and so on.They measure people's implicit view of a certain field by means of an evaluation questionnaire.The purpose of this study is to explore the implicit concept of success among high school students.Since success is the ideal state that human beings have been pursuing from the beginning to the end,it has important driving force and value-oriented function,so the implicit view of success may have important influence on individual psychology and even mental health.In view of this,this paper selects high school students,who are likely to be greatly influenced by their personal success implicit view,and discusses the status quo of their success implicit view and its relationship with learning procrastination behavior on the basis of the self-compiled questionnaire of high school students' success implicit view.In terms of the preparation of high school students' successful implicit view questionnaire,this study takes relevant researches at home and abroad as the theoretical basis,combines the results of open survey and data collection,and preliminarily prepares the preliminary questionnaire of high school students' successful implicit view.The results of the preliminary questionnaire were analyzed by the corresponding data processing method,and a formal questionnaire was prepared.The questionnaire contains 34 questions,which are divided into five dimensions:breaking through self-limitation,having external beauty,achieving stage goals,achieving internal pursuit,and maintaining excellent state.The overall internal consistency reliability of the questionnaire was 0.908,and the sub-reliability was 0.852.In the status quo of high school students' successful implicit view,the breakthrough self-restricted dimension has the highest score,the average score of the project is 4.340,and the score of the target dimension is the lowest,and the average score of the project is 3.581.In addition,gender,grade,only-child status,family ranking,family origin,mother's education level and class ranking variables all have some differences in different dimensions,while age,father's education level and left-behind experience have little difference in different dimensions.In the study of the relationship between successful implicit and learning procrastination in high school students,the study delay questionnaire with good faith and validity and the prepared formal questionnaire were used to conduct the test to explore the relationship between the two.Through research and analysis,it can be seen that there is a significant negative correlation between the internal dimensions of successful implicitness of high school students and learning delay behavior,and it has a significant predictive effect on learning delay behavior.The conclusions of this study are as follows:(1)The questionnaire of high school students' implicit view of success includes five dimensions: having external beauty,achieving stage goal,breaking through self-limitation,maintaining excellent state and achieving internal pursuit.(2)In this study,the homogeneity and semi-reliability of the questionnaire were tested,and the results showed that the reliability of the questionnaire was within the standard range of psychometrics,indicating that the questionnaire had good reliability.(3)This study investigated the structure validity,content validity and correlation analysis of the questionnaire.The results of correlation factor analysisshowed that the correlation between each dimension of the questionnaire and between the dimension and the total questionnaire reached the significance level,indicating that each dimension constituted an organic whole.The correlation between each dimension was moderate,and the correlation between each dimension and the total questionnaire was high,indicating that there was a certain degree of independence among the dimensions.The results of confirmatory factor analysis showed that the indicators of model fitting were basically within the standard range of psychometrics,and the questionnaire was approved by the teachers of senior high school students and on-the-job senior high school students during the compilation process,indicating that it was in line with the current situation of senior high school students in China.The above results showed that the questionnaire had good validity.(4)High school students' implicit view of success has significant differences in demographic variables such as gender,grade and class performance ranking,but no differences in age and left-behind experience.(5)High school students' learning procrastination behavior has significant differences in gender,class performance ranking,and there is no difference in demographic variables such as age,one-child status,family ranking,and family source.(6)There is a significant negative correlation between the inner dimension of high school students' success implicit view and learning procrastination,and it has a certain prediction effect on learning procrastination.However,there is no significant correlation between the two potential dimensions of success implicit theory and learning procrastination.
